Bulgur Pilaf with Lentils (Mercimekli Bulgur Pilavı)

















Ingredients

2 ½ cup coarse bulgur
4 ½ cup water
½ cup green lentils
1 potato, chopped
½ stick of butter
2 tsp salt  

Instructions

- Wash and place green lentils in a pan and pour water enough to cover it. Boil about 15 minutes until lentils are soft. Then drain.
- Boil the potato the same way in a pan until it becomes soft.
- Boil 4 ½ cup water in another pan in high heat. 
- Add lentils, bulgur, potato and salt. Let it boil again before turning heat to low.
- Close the pots lid and cook until the water is all absorbed.
- Melt butter in a small pan. Pour it onto the rice and stir.
- Close the pots lid back to let it rest for 20 minutes.
- Serve warm. 


 

Pub Style Bulgur Pilaf (Meyhane Usulü Bulgur Pilavı)


 
















Bulgur is one of the most commonly used grains in Turkey. It has two different types, coarse bulgur and fine bulgur. You can find many appetizers, main dishes and even soups prepared with bulgur. It is known to be more nutritious than white rice, so all the more reason for its frequent use. Whether they are prepared with coarse or fine bulgur, the bulgur dishes I've tried so far always taste so good, they leave you wanting for more.

Ingredients

2 ½ cups of coarse bulgur, washed
1 medium sized onion, diced
½ tbsp tomato or pepper paste
4 ½ cups of hot water
1 tsp red pepper flakes
2 tbsp dry sweet basil, crumbled
6 tbsp olive oil or 2 tbsp butter
1 ½ tsp salt to taste

Instructions

- Place the oil and onions in a pan and cook them in low heat until the onions turn lightly brown.
- Add half of the butter, tomato and pepper pastes. Let them melt, then add bulgur, red pepper flakes and salt. Stir for 2-3 minutes.
- Add the water and remaining half of the butter, and turn the heat to high for water to boil again. When it has boiled, turn down the heat to low and add dry basil. 
- Close the pots lid and cook until the water is all absorbed.
- Now you can serve within 10 minutes.
